In a nutshell you are basically cleaning up any protrusions, imperfections, abrupt bends in the runners and plenum. This maximizes airflow which increases hp/tq due to a smoother intake tract. This is a great mod for both for turbo and especially n/a cars where your goal is to optimize what you have since you do not have the luxury of turning up boost. Ported intakes pair nicely with a set of hot cams.

It actually is the plastic that gets dremeled away. The upper intake gets the silencing ridges removed and the TB port opened a bit. The lower gets the bunges around the injectors cleaned up and smoothed over while the ports leading into the head get opened up quite a bit.

Peak gains have been shown to be 15-20 rwhp with gains through the curve a bit higher at 20-25 rwhp.

A guy on the cyclone facebook group does it for about $300 I believe. Other than a tune it is the best bang for the buck mod for the cyclones.
